454 views|4 replies

12

Posts

0

Resources
The OP
 

I want to get started with secure machine learning, what should I do? [Copy link]

 

I want to get started with secure machine learning, what should I do?

This post is from Q&A

Latest reply

Very good electronic information, the summary is very detailed and has reference value. Thank you for sharing   Details Published on 2024-6-20 07:42
 
 

16

Posts

0

Resources
2
 

Secure machine learning is an interdisciplinary subject involving machine learning and information security. Getting started with secure machine learning can be done by following the steps below:

  1. Learn the basics of machine learning: First, you need to understand the basic principles and common algorithms of machine learning, including supervised learning, unsupervised learning, reinforcement learning, etc. You can learn the basics of machine learning through online courses, textbooks, or MOOC courses.

  2. Learn the basics of information security: Understanding the basic concepts, attack methods, and defense methods of information security is essential for secure machine learning. You can deepen your understanding by learning knowledge in network security, cryptography, malware analysis, etc.

  3. Understand the challenges and coping strategies of secure machine learning: Secure machine learning faces many challenges, such as adversarial sample attacks, privacy protection, model interpretability, etc. Learn about relevant research results and solutions, and understand how to deal with these challenges.

  4. Learn secure machine learning techniques and tools: Understand the currently popular secure machine learning techniques and tools, such as adversarial sample detection methods, privacy protection techniques, model interpretation methods, etc. You can read relevant research papers and technical documents, or participate in relevant training courses.

  5. Practical projects: Try to carry out some simple projects in the field of secure machine learning, such as adversarial sample attack detection, privacy protection model training, etc. Through practical projects, deepen the understanding of secure machine learning technologies and methods.

  6. References and community support: When you encounter problems during the learning process, you can consult relevant literature and technical documents, as well as some online resources and community forums. Communicate and discuss with peers, solve problems together, and learn from each other.

  7. Continuous learning and research: Secure machine learning is a field that is constantly developing and evolving. We must continue to learn new technologies and methods, keep an eye on the latest research results, and actively participate in related research and practical activities.

By following the above steps, you can gradually get started with secure machine learning and master some basic techniques and methods. I wish you a smooth learning!

This post is from Q&A
 
 
 

10

Posts

0

Resources
3
 

Secure machine learning is the field of applying machine learning techniques to ensure system security and defend against various threats. Here are some tips for those who are experienced in the electronics field to get started with secure machine learning:

  1. Learn the basics of machine learning : First, make sure you have a basic understanding of the field of machine learning, including common machine learning algorithms, model training and evaluation methods, etc.

  2. Gain in-depth understanding of the security field : Learn the basic concepts, threat models, attack techniques and defense methods in the security field. Understand common types of security attacks, such as malware, network attacks, social engineering, etc., as well as corresponding defense measures.

  3. Master the theory of secure machine learning : Learn the theories and methods of secure machine learning, including adversarial machine learning, secure enhanced learning, privacy protection, etc. Understand the challenges and solutions of secure machine learning.

  4. Familiarity with secure machine learning tools and frameworks : Master common secure machine learning tools and frameworks, such as TensorFlow Privacy, IBM Adversarial Robustness Toolbox, etc. These tools and frameworks provide rich functions and algorithms that can be used to implement secure machine learning models.

  5. Participate in relevant courses and training : Attend courses, training or seminars related to secure machine learning to learn the latest technologies and research results in the industry and understand best practices and case studies.

  6. Read relevant literature and research papers : Read academic journals, conference papers, and professional books to learn about the latest research results and technological advances in the field of secure machine learning and keep track of cutting-edge trends in the industry.

  7. Practical project development : Select some practical projects of secure machine learning for development and implementation, such as malware detection, intrusion detection, security authentication, etc. Through practical projects, you can consolidate the knowledge you have learned and accumulate practical experience.

  8. Participate in security communities and forums : Join professional communities and online forums in the security field to exchange experiences, share problems and solutions with other security experts and researchers, expand your network, and accelerate your learning and growth.

By following the above steps, you can gradually get started with secure machine learning and continuously improve your skills in practice. I wish you good luck in your studies!

This post is from Q&A
 
 
 

9

Posts

0

Resources
4
 

To get started with secure machine learning, you can follow these steps:

  1. Learn basic machine learning knowledge: Before you start learning secure machine learning, make sure you have a basic understanding of the basic concepts, algorithms, and techniques of machine learning, including supervised learning, unsupervised learning, deep learning, etc.

  2. Understand the concept of secure machine learning: Secure machine learning is a subfield that applies machine learning technology to the security field, aiming to improve the robustness of the model and prevent malicious attacks and misuse. Learn the basic concepts and principles of secure machine learning, including adversarial attacks, defense methods, etc.

  3. Choose appropriate learning resources: Look for relevant learning resources, including books, online courses, tutorials, and papers, etc. Some well-known academic institutions and research institutions may also provide relevant courses and resources.

  4. Master secure machine learning technologies: Learn common secure machine learning technologies, including adversarial machine learning, secure enhanced learning, privacy-preserving machine learning, etc. Understand the principles, methods, and application scenarios of these technologies.

  5. Familiarity with security datasets and evaluation standards: Understand common security datasets and evaluation standards, including adversarial attack datasets and evaluation metrics. Through practice and research, master how to use these datasets for model evaluation and comparison.

  6. Participate in practical projects: Participate in actual secure machine learning projects and improve your abilities through practice. You can try to build secure machine learning models and conduct research and experiments on specific security issues.

  7. Follow the latest research and development: Secure machine learning is an evolving field, and you need to keep up with the latest research results and technological advances. Read relevant papers, blogs, and news, and attend relevant conferences and workshops.

  8. Join communities and forums: Join communities and forums in the field of secure machine learning to exchange experiences and share resources with other researchers and practitioners. This will help you learn and grow better.

By following the above steps, you can gradually master the basic knowledge and skills of secure machine learning and continuously improve your abilities in practice. I wish you a smooth study!

This post is from Q&A
 
 
 

889

Posts

0

Resources
5
 

Very good electronic information, the summary is very detailed and has reference value. Thank you for sharing

This post is from Q&A
 
 
 

Guess Your Favourite
Find a datasheet?

EEWorld Datasheet Technical Support

Related articles more>>

EEWorld
subscription
account

EEWorld
service
account

Automotive
development
circle

Copyright © 2005-2024 EEWORLD.com.cn, Inc. All rights reserved 京B2-20211791 京ICP备10001474号-1 电信业务审批[2006]字第258号函 京公网安备 11010802033920号
快速回复 返回顶部 Return list